The station is equipped with several essential amenities designed to enhance your travel experience. The ticket facilities include an office open from Monday to Saturday, typically operating from morning until early afternoon. For those looking for flexibility in ticket collection, there are automated machines available too. However, note that these machines do not accept cash, accepting major debit and credit cards only.
Accessibility is a priority at Runcorn East. While certain areas offer step-free access, do bear in mind that transitions between platforms require the use of a footbridge. Unfortunately, there are no waiting rooms or refreshment facilities, so travelers might plan their visit accordingly. The station compensates with helpful staff and numerous screens detailing arrivals and departures, ensuring you’re always informed about your travel plans.
Runcorn East serves as a gateway to a multitude of onward travel options. The station offers convenient access to local bus services, perfect for connecting with regional destinations. If you're transitioning from rail to bus, access is straightforward with stops located a short walk from the station. While there’s no bicycle hire facility, cyclists will find ample space dedicated to bicycle storage, protected with CCTV for added security.
If rail services are disrupted, a rail replacement bus stop ensures you can continue your journey with minimal hassle. Unfortunately, if you're relying on taxis or require accessible vehicles, options may be limited and advance arrangements are advisable.

Exton Station, while picturesque, caters to travelers with basic amenities. There is no ticket office or machines for purchasing or collecting tickets, so it's essential to book your travel online and plan ahead. Smartcards are not issued or validated at the station either. However, there is an induction loop available, supporting hearing aid users, and step-free access is offered to some areas of the station, making it somewhat wheelchair accessible.
Lacking in extensive facilities such as shops or toilets, Exton Station prioritizes simplicity. There is, however, a seating area for resting while waiting for your train. If you require assistance, there is a help point available, ensuring that you can confidentially navigate your journey. For any inquiries about your travel or the latest schedule updates, the staff at the help point are your go-to.
For onward travel from Exton Station, options are somewhat limited, yet still accommodating. Rail replacement services and taxis are accessible near the Puffing Billy on the main road, although no official taxi rank is available directly at the station. Planning to cycle your way around? Bicycle storage is present at the station entrance, allowing for a seamless transition from train to bike. To help plan your onward journey by bus, check out the printable information here.
